Pjatigorsk vs Rangoon, Yangon Climate & Distance Between

Myanmar flag
  • The distance between Pjatigorsk, Russia and Rangoon, Yangon, Myanmar is approximately 5,800 km or 3,604 mi.
  • To reach Pjatigorsk in this distance one would set out from Rangoon, Yangon bearing 313.3° or NW and follow the great circles arc to approach Pjatigorsk bearing 284.1° or WNW .
  • Pjatigorsk has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b) whereas Rangoon, Yangon has a tropical monsoonal climate (Am).
  • Pjatigorsk is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ome whereas Rangoon, Yangon is in or near the tropical moist forest biome.
  • The mean annual temperature is 18.7 °C (33.7°F) cooler.
  • Average monthly temperatures vary by 19 °C (34.2°F) more in Pjatigorsk. The continentality subtype is subcontinental as opposed to truly hyperoceanic.
  • Total annual precipitation averages 2128.5 mm (83.8 in) less which is equivalent to 2128.5 l/m² (52.24 US gal/ft²) or 21,285,000 l/ha (2,275,508 US gal/ac) less. About 1/5 as much.
  • The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 24.9° lower in Pjatigorsk than in Rangoon, Yangon.
